首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否可以使用testcafe/node模拟由按钮单击触发的函数的结果?

是的,可以使用testcafe/node模拟由按钮单击触发的函数的结果。

TestCafe是一个用于自动化Web浏览器测试的工具,它可以模拟用户与网页进行交互的行为,包括点击按钮、填写表单等操作。通过使用TestCafe的API,您可以编写测试代码来模拟按钮的点击,并验证相应函数的结果。

以下是一个示例代码,演示了如何使用TestCafe模拟按钮点击并验证函数的结果:

代码语言:txt
复制
import { Selector } from 'testcafe';

fixture `Button Test`
    .page `https://example.com`;

test('Simulate button click and verify result', async t => {
    // 点击按钮
    await t.click('#myButton');

    // 获取结果元素
    const resultElement = Selector('#result');

    // 验证结果
    await t.expect(resultElement.innerText).eql('Expected Result');
});

在上面的示例中,我们首先使用click方法模拟了按钮的点击操作。然后,使用Selector选择器获取了结果元素,并使用expect断言验证了结果是否符合预期。

通过使用TestCafe,您可以编写更复杂的测试用例,模拟各种用户交互行为,并验证相应函数的结果。这对于前端开发和软件测试非常有用。

腾讯云提供了一系列与云计算相关的产品,例如云服务器、云数据库、云存储等。您可以根据具体需求选择适合的产品来支持您的云计算应用。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云产品的信息。

相关搜索:验证在使用withFormik的handleSubmit时,是否在单击按钮时调用模拟函数单击按钮时,是否可以增加setTimeout函数中的时间值?是否可以在使用Powershell的应用程序中单击按钮?是否可以使用Node测试库Rewire来模拟对同一函数的两个调用,以便它们返回不同的结果?是否可以使用css或scss在不使用javascript的情况下仅在单击按钮时触发动画是否可以保存在JavaScript上单击的元素,以供以后在函数中使用?是否有一个函数可以根据所单击的按钮返回数字(当被调用时是否可以在运行时使用Node.js中的函数生成对象?(Next/react)从子组件中的按钮单击刷新SWR -我可以使用回调吗??(函数对函数)是否可以使用相同的触发器,以不规则的时间间隔运行相同的函数?使用模拟的按钮单击来测试函数调用,但代码覆盖率显示其未经过测试是否可以使用或导入CharJVM.kt文件中的函数,该文件是由Kotlin平台定义的内联函数集合?是否可以使用自动占位符来推导非类型模板参数的函数结果?在使用Python3.x的tkinter中,是否可以使用刻度和复选按钮来调用相同的函数?是否可以在两个单独的文件中使用云函数、后台触发器和快速应用程序?是否可以使用scheduleAtFixedRate在每个月的第一个月触发一个函数?您是否可以将onclick函数添加到innerHTML类中,然后使用event.target从所单击的特定div中提取div?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

16分8秒

人工智能新途-用路由器集群模仿神经元集群

领券